2023-2024 Graduate Catalog 
CSCI 521 - iOS Mobile Device Programming

Comprehensive introduction to building applications for mobile devices that use Apple’s iOS operating system. Topics include application of Model-View-Controller design architecture, graphics, rich media content, multithreading, networking and interaction with hardware sensors. Extensive laboratory work. May not be taken by students with undergraduate credit for CSCI 321.

Prerequisites & Notes
PRQ: Admission to the graduate program in computer science or consent of department.

Credits: 4